Chapter 32

Same Day

Lily, James, and Sirius were trying to get the Grimmauld Place dust under control for the order meeting that night.

"Why do we even bother? Every speck of dust we clean up, 1,000 more appear. The place is just plain cursed with dust." James whined. Sirius looked at James like he just told him the meaning of life.

"That explains a lot!" He said. Lily glared at the two friends and rolled her eyes. The front door opened and Remus stepped in, looking slightly paler than usual. A sign that the full moon would be approaching.

"You OK mate?" Sirius asked him.

"Nothing I'm not used to." Remus stated, sadly. "You guys need anything?" He asked, looking around the place with an eyebrow raised slightly.

"Just getting everything ready for tonight." Lily answered.

"How's Harry?" Remus asked.

"Still doesn't remember, but other than that, he seems fine." James said, glancing tentatively over at Lily. He knew his wife was a tid bit over protective of Harry. He had to admit, there were times he was too. Anyone would be if the most evil wizard alive was after their son and wanted him dead for reasons only the sick twisted wizard knew. But some times, she could be too over protective. The poor kid needed to have some fun.

"We want Dumbledore to get Pomfrey here to make sure he's not on a memory charm." Lily stated, looking concerned.

"I'm sure he'll be fine." James said, wrapping his arms around her waist.

The rest of the order members started to arrive at that moment. Everyone sat down in their usual seats. Dumbledore was the last to arrive with Professor McGonagall (does anyone else wonder if the two of them are secretly dating in the series???).

Dumbledore took his usual place at the head of the table and called the group to Order and addressed everyone.

"Hello all. Is there anything anyone wants to address?"

"Albus, I believe we should skip to the Death Eater activity." McGonagall suggested.

"First things first." Dumbledore said, looking over at Sirius, Lily, and James. "How's Harry?" the headmaster inquired.

"He's fin-"

"He's not fine!" Lily interrupted James. "He doesn't remember anything."

"Those things take time, Lily." Tonks said, and Lily shot the younger woman a glare.

"We don't have time." Lily pointed out.

"She's right. I mean, Harry's more important that any of us realize." Remus stated and noted Snape's frown.

"Yes, but pushing Harry to remember can't be good for the boy either." Tonks stated.

"We don't even know if he will remember." Snape spoke up, looking annoyed with the conversation topic.

"True…we don't know the nature of the amnesia, but"

"Albus, we should have Madam Pomfrey check for memory charms." Lily stated. "If he's under a charm, at least we'll know."

Dumbledore nodded in agreement.

"I'll contact her in the morning." Dumbledore stated and glanced at his other members. No one said anything. "Moving on then…as you all know, Death Eater activity has been on the rise after recent events…" Dumbledore paused and reached into his pocket. "Lemon Drop anyone?" He offered, the table, and they all sighed and rolled their eyes at Dumbledore's antics. Lily swore that sometimes that man had ADD greater than Sirius Black. And that was saying something. Dumbledore popped a lemon drop in his mouth; looking slightly disappointed no one else wanted one and continued. "Voldemort seems to be working hard to find both Harry and Destany. We all need to be on the alert."

"Speaking of the Spray Girl, what are we going to do with her?" Snape asked.

"Destany Ravin will be coming to Hogwarts early as an independent study. She will then test into a year at the end of summer and be sorted with the other first years. Though I suspect she will be in Ravenclaw..being who her ancestors are." Dumbledore stated and looked at his professors. "It would be appreciated if Hogwarts Professors would offer the girl some assistance."

Both professors nodded but Snape looked more annoyed than usual.

The meeting continued late into the night, discussing the next course of action and the rise in recent Death Eater activity.
